ELF Cup
The ELF Cup (abbreviation for Egalité, Liberté, Fraternité ) was a soccer championship organized in 2006 by the North Cyprus Football Association (KTFF). It was designed for teams that were not organized in FIFA and thus could not take part in the FIFA World Cup.
Emergence
The NF board , in which most of the teams are organized, originally wanted to hold its Viva World Cup 2006 in the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us. However, due to political pressure and disagreements with the KTFF, the competition was moved to Occitania in the south of France .
As a reaction to this, the KTFF started its own “Underdog World Cup” in the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us. Some of the teams that were traded as participants in the Viva World Cup in the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us then declared their participation in the 2006 ELF Cup , while other teams on the NF board went to Occitania for the 2006 Viva World Cup, which was taking place at the same time .
ELF Cup 2006
The ELF Cup 2006 took place between November 19 and 25, 2006 in the internationally unrecognized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us . The preliminary round was played in two groups with a total of eight teams - in the three stadiums of Güzelyurt , Girne and Gazimağusa . The games of the main round were played up to the final in Lefkoşa .
Interestingly, the most recently registered participants from Kyrgyzstan and Tajikistan are official members of AFC and FIFA , which contradicts the actual idea of the ELF Cup.
